From a legendary guitarist hailing from Kansas City, we begin the 828th Episode of Neon Jazz with live music from Danny Embrey at the Green Lady Lounge followed by rising star vibraphonist Atley King. We spin new music from Claudia Villa, T.K. Blue, Elmar Frey and the Kevin Hays trio, Ben Street and Billy Hart. We also sprinkle in a few classics from Dave Brubeck and Wayne Shorter. Finally, we tie the hour together with previously unreleased music from the legendary Cal Tjader from set of 1960's live shows in Seattle. Dig the jazz, my friends.Playlist
